    Current upstream kernel hangs with mips and powerpc targets in
    uniprocessor mode if SECCOMP is configured.

    Bisect points to commit dbd952127d11 ("seccomp: introduce writer locking").
    Turns out that code such as
             BUG_ON(!spin_is_locked(&list_lock));
    can not be used in uniprocessor mode because spin_is_locked() always
    returns false in this configuration, and that assert_spin_locked()
    exists for that very purpose and must be used instead.

    Fixes: dbd952127d11 ("seccomp: introduce writer locking")

    diff --git a/kernel/fork.c b/kernel/fork.c
    index 1380d8a..0cf9cdb 100644
    --- a/kernel/fork.c
    +++ b/kernel/fork.c
    @@ -1105,7 +1105,7 @@ static void copy_seccomp(struct task_struct *p)
              * needed because this new task is not yet running and cannot
              * be racing exec.
              */
    -       BUG_ON(!spin_is_locked(&current->sighand->siglock));
    +       assert_spin_locked(&current->sighand->siglock);

             /* Ref-count the new filter user, and assign it. */
             get_seccomp_filter(current);
    diff --git a/kernel/seccomp.c b/kernel/seccomp.c
    index 25b0043..44eb005 100644
    --- a/kernel/seccomp.c
    +++ b/kernel/seccomp.c
    @@ -203,7 +203,7 @@ static u32 seccomp_run_filters(int syscall)

      static inline bool seccomp_may_assign_mode(unsigned long seccomp_mode)
      {
    -       BUG_ON(!spin_is_locked(&current->sighand->siglock));
    +       assert_spin_locked(&current->sighand->siglock);

             if (current->seccomp.mode && current->seccomp.mode != seccomp_mode)
                     return false;
    @@ -214,7 +214,7 @@ static inline bool seccomp_may_assign_mode(unsigned 
long seccomp_mode)
      static inline void seccomp_assign_mode(struct task_struct *task,
                                            unsigned long seccomp_mode)
      {
    -       BUG_ON(!spin_is_locked(&task->sighand->siglock));
    +       assert_spin_locked(&task->sighand->siglock);

             task->seccomp.mode = seccomp_mode;
             /*
    @@ -253,7 +253,7 @@ static inline pid_t seccomp_can_sync_threads(void)
             struct task_struct *thread, *caller;

             BUG_ON(!mutex_is_locked(&current->signal->cred_guard_mutex));
    -       BUG_ON(!spin_is_locked(&current->sighand->siglock));
    +       assert_spin_locked(&current->sighand->siglock);

             /* Validate all threads being eligible for synchronization. */
             caller = current;
    @@ -294,7 +294,7 @@ static inline void seccomp_sync_threads(void)
             struct task_struct *thread, *caller;

             BUG_ON(!mutex_is_locked(&current->signal->cred_guard_mutex));
    -       BUG_ON(!spin_is_locked(&current->sighand->siglock));
    +       assert_spin_locked(&current->sighand->siglock);

             /* Synchronize all threads. */
             caller = current;
    @@ -464,7 +464,7 @@ static long seccomp_attach_filter(unsigned int flags,
             unsigned long total_insns;
             struct seccomp_filter *walker;

    -       BUG_ON(!spin_is_locked(&current->sighand->siglock));
    +       assert_spin_locked(&current->sighand->siglock);

             /* Validate resulting filter length. */
             total_insns = filter->prog->len;
